Just picked this up for IOS -iphone 5. Thanks! The wait for WOTA (wolves of the atlantic) has been painful (and still is).
I have been playing sub sims since about 1985. The first was GATO on the IBM PC Jr. I also had Silent Service around 1991-2 on a PC 286. Also have Silent Hunter on PC. Gaming is going to mobile with more powerful phones and processors so I do not game on my PC any more. The PC is dying off. I just gave this game a 5 star review at apps store because there is nothing like it on IOS. I don't count Silent Hunter on IOS because it never has been updated, and I never downloaded. I have a few comments. 1) a career path for U-boat captains 2) Don't know if the water graphics can be improved (appearance) 3) add a random rolling wave pattern - the waves seem to roll too fast 4) periscope too stationary - maybe bob slightly with waves with water splashing on lens 5) tweak AI for destroyers - when battle /patrol starts, the sub is at periscope depth with engines off. I fire 3 torpedoes and immediately dive to 50 feet (with engines still off, periscope down). When the torpedoes hit the target, the destroyers immediately converge on my location. I should have been undetectable or almost undetectable (engines off, submerged). In Silent Hunter, the destroyers would have spread out looking for a sonar signal - not gone straight to my location immediately. 6) It seems it takes a lot to die (sink sub). I have never been sunk with depth charges. So as a test, I surfaced 3 times with 2-3 destroyers, and it took a long time to be sunk. 7) not sure how the difficulty level is determined - I would increase accuracy of depth charge drops (higher chance of being hit) but not how fast you could be detected. It seems the higher level, the more escorts are with the convoys ( I would still have no escorts or a few escorts at higher difficulty level). 8) external camera view would be neat 9) sub sinking - when your sub sinks in Silent Hunter, the screen immediately cuts to a summary report. Boring. In the old 1985 GATO sub game, when you were sunk, the screen would crack as the hull would break and water would pour in and fill up the screen - a little more dramatic than a cut screen thanks! |
